📚 Contexto Histórico
In the Book of Job, which is set in ancient times during the patriarchal era, Job is a righteous man enduring severe trials and debating with his friends about his suffering and God's justice. Elihu, a younger character who speaks in chapters 32-37, interjects to defend God's wisdom and urges Job to humbly seek divine instruction rather than question the Almighty. This verse captures Elihu's counsel for Job to ask God to reveal hidden faults and commit to abandoning sin.
